The Hole in Wand, a popular crazy golf attraction at Dalton Park in County Durham, has announced it will close permanently on Sunday 6 September 2026. The news was confirmed in a statement shared on the attraction's Facebook page on Wednesday evening.
Opened in October 2024, the magical mini golf course quickly became a standout family experience at Dalton Park, welcoming nearly 70,000 visitors. Players could pick a wand, solve riddles and break a curse across nine themed holes, with references to North East landmarks such as Bolam Lake and Lumley Castle.
Award-winning attraction
Earlier this year, The Hole in Wand was named among the top 10% of attractions globally after receiving a Tripadvisor Travellers' Choice Award. The attraction also featured an apothecary and a Little Wizards' play area, alongside imaginative cocktails for adults.
Fond farewell
The Facebook statement read: "Wizards and Witches, it is with sadness that we will be saying a fond farewell to the North East and Dalton Park on Sunday 6th September 2026. We have loved being part of the centre's offering over the last 2 years and thank all who visited our magical mini golf, apothecary and Little Wizards' play area."
